Three Mile Island burst into the nation’s headlines twenty-five years ago, forever changing our view of nuclear power. The dramatic accident held the world’s attention for an unsettling week in March 1979 as engineers struggled to understand what had happened and to bring the damaged reactor to a safe condition. Much has been written since then about TMI, but it is not easy to find up-to-date information that is both reliable and accessible to the non-scientific reader. TMI offers a much needed "one-stop" resource for a new generation of citizens, students, and policy makers.
The legacy of Three Mile Island has been far reaching. The worst nuclear accident in U.S. history marked a turning point in our policies, our perceptions, and our national identity. Those involved in the nuclear industry today study the scenario carefully and review the decontamination and recovery process. Risk management and the ability to rationally and understandably convey risks to the general population are an integral part of implementation of new technologies. Political, environmental, and energy decisions have been made with TMI as a factor, and while studies reveal little environmental damage from the accident, long term studies of health effects continue. TMI presents a balanced and factual account of the accident, the cleanup effort, and the many facets of its legacy twenty-five years later.
